Bees don’t always die after stinging, the reason they do is because they leave there stinger stuck in your skin along with some other internals so that it will continue to pump venom in. This loss of internals is what kills them if you pull a bee that has stung you out carefully and keep the stinger attached they will be perfectly fine.

The stingers have barbs which face the opposite way to the stinger, like a hook.

When they pull away the stinger comes off the bee along with its organs, the stinger stays embedded and the bee dies shortly after
